    I just recarpeted my 03 185 stratos, I used 20 oz. from boat carpet sales, it looks awesome, but if i had to do it again id buy 24oz just because its a little thicker,which should last a little longer. just a little helpful advice , for the money and time saved go to lowes and buy a ROCKWELL SONIC CRAFTER , get some flexible blades, saves tons of time scraping their awesome!!!!!!!!! grab a gallon of acetone also gets off all the excess residue.     My Dad and I went with 20 oz. carpet straight from Ranger, and I have no idea how much it cost, as he paid for most of it (I threw him some money, and he took care of the rest).

    I don't have any complaints. I wanted to get carpet from Basscat, based on most suggestions, but my Dad was stubborn and stuck with Ranger. That was actually a good thing, as most of the lids are pretty damn tight with the 20 oz carpet. If I had gone with 24 oz, I would have had to shave the carpet down on the lid faces in order to open them.

    Even after a full season of fishing, the livewell lids, and adjacent lids, still require two people to open them because the carpet is so tight. I had hoped a full season would wear it in, but I think at this point I have no choice but to shave the faces down on that.

    Before you order, measure, measure, and measure again, the gaps between lids, to make sure you don't order carpet that is too thick.
